Cost of Training by Coach Ed Poirier
Dear Ed,
I'm working on a fourth-grade project about what it would take to become an Olympic athlete in running.
I need to find how much it costs to start training. I know you need running clothes and shoes. Are there any other expenses I need to save up for?
Thank you very much,
Megan
Photo courtesy of photosbyjohn.net
Hi Megan,
My favorite letter all year!
One of the big benefits of running is all you need is a shirt, a pair of summer shorts or winter running pants, and a well-fitting pair of running shoes. Shirts, shorts, and pants you already have, so the only expense is for the running shoes.
For a fourth-grade student shoes will cost about $25 to $50 and will last until you grow out of them so maybe 2 pair a year. That's it.
Get those shoes and start training. I'll look for you in the 2020 or 2024 Olympics!
